导读:Redis是一种高性能的键值存储数据库,而Redisbpop则是其提供的一种阻塞式列表弹出操作。本文将为大家介绍Redisbpop的相关知识。
1. Redisbpop是什么?
Redisbpop是Redis提供的一种阻塞式列表弹出操作。它可以在列表为空时阻塞连接,直到有新元素被加入到列表中才能返回结果。
2. Redisbpop的使用方法
使用Redisbpop需要先建立一个连接,然后指定要弹出的列表名称和超时时间。如果超时时间到了仍然没有新元素加入列表,则连接会自动断开。
3. Redisbpop的优点
Redisbpop可以避免轮询操作,减少服务器的负担。同时,由于它是阻塞式的,所以可以保证数据的实时性和可靠性。
4. Redisbpop的应用场景
Redisbpop适用于需要实时获取数据的场景,比如在线聊天室、消息队列等。
总结:Redisbpop是Redis提供的一种阻塞式列表弹出操作,可以避免轮询操作,保证数据的实时性和可靠性,在实时获取数据的场景下有广泛的应用。